1. Mindfulness in Sexual Practices

Mindfulness involves being fully present in the moment without judgment. By applying mindfulness to sexual practices, couples can create a safe space for emotional connections to flourish.

Techniques for Mindfulness in Intimacy

  • Focused Breathing: Synchronize your breathing patterns with your partner. Inhale and exhale together, deepening your connection and fostering relaxation.
  • Sensory Awareness: Engage your senses by focusing on the textures, scents, and sounds surrounding you. This approach can enhance the erotic atmosphere and deepen intimacy.

3. Exploration of Sensual and Sexual Techniques

Sex Nyepong emphasizes how intertwined sensual and sexual experiences can enhance intimacy. Exploring different touch techniques, using body language, and embracing sensuality can invigorate your sexual relationship.

Examples of Various Techniques

  • Sensate Focus: A therapeutic exercise that encourages partners to explore each other’s bodies without the goal of intercourse. This can enhance eroticism and emotional connection.
  • Erotic Massage: Spend time giving and receiving massages to deepen physical and sensual touch.

Practical Steps to Incorporate Sex Nyepong into Your Relationship

Enhancing your relationship through Sex Nyepong practices requires intention and effort. Follow these steps to incorporate these practices into your relationship:

Step 1: Build a Foundation of Trust

Establish open, honest communication with your partner. Relational trust is crucial for deepening intimacy and ensuring that both partners feel safe expressing their desires.

Step 2: Set the Scene

Create an atmosphere conducive to intimate encounters. Consider dim lighting, calming scents (like candles or essential oils), and comfortable seating to enhance the experience.

Step 3: Prioritize Connection

Take time to reconnect emotionally before engaging in sexual activities. Engage in slow conversations, reminiscing about shared experiences, and expressing affection non-sexually.

Step 4: Schedule Regular Intimacy Retreats

Designate a time each week or month specifically for intimate practices. This time should be regarded as sacred and prioritized amidst your busy lives.

Step 5: Reflect and Communicate

After engaging in intimacy practices, set time aside to discuss experiences openly. Share what felt good, what could be improved, and explore each other’s desires.
